Geocache Description:


ATTENTION – NO OFF-ROADING IN THIS AREA ie. Don’t use the track along the powerlines – to reach the cache you can drive to within 100 metres on the road, park and then walk – there may appear to be tracks leading in from other directions but you are breaking the law to use them as this is a regional park.



A Secure Site for TravelBugs and Geocoins to rest whilst awaiting the next ride.



Do you have a travel bug that you might have shown around but need to drop him off because you are no longer heading where he wants to go?



Don't have time to seek out a cache to place him or the cache you found just doesnt seem appropriate?



Looking for a totally secure spot where he will be safe until the next lift?



Well here's the answer to your TB prayers!!



This ammo container cache box is located in an area which is safe, secure and sheltered from the elements. Its relatively easy to access when passing through town and can be used as a set down point for Bugs who have had a look around and now are travelling north or hoping to go back down south.



As an added bonus for the owners of TB's who choose this facility to spend a night or two we are offering a complimentary make-over. ie - we are able to refresh ziplock bags, attach new laminated mission statements, etc etc. And owners if you would prefer your TB to stay around Geraldton for a while after its stay please let us know and we will assist in dropping him into another nearby cache.
